Week 9, an Exciting Time!
Hello Parents!
As you already know, this week holds a lot of excitement for us! For starters...
Language Arts:
We will be looking closely at cause and effect relationships. We will also be examining homophones and homographs. Our communities unit is still in full swing, and we will be learning how to use adjectives to describe different nouns in our community.
Math:
Our multiplication unit has only just begun! We will be looking at various story problems, and two-step word problems involving multiplication. We will also take a closer look at our 0s, 1s, 2s, and 5s facts.
Science:
Now that we are experts on matter, we will be investigating what happens when you apply and remove heat from different states of matter.
